The development of the processes of biogenic sediment- and morphogenesis on the territory of Central Belarus

Abstract

The peculiarities of the developments of modern biogenic geological processes on the territory of Central Belarus are considered in the article. The research grounded on the analysis of published scientific, cartographic and fund materials, field works, route observations and measuring, the materials of distance shooting. It is established that marshes formation is one of the most active indicating modern biogenic geological process, developing on the area around 8000 km2 and characterized by the accumulation of peat and the formation of the peculiar complex of phytogenic relief. Soils bogging develops on the area around 17 700 km2. The conditions and factors of biogenic and sediment- and morphogenesis are described. The accumulation of organogenic sediments (sapropel and peat) take their place also in basins of nature and artificial origin and till the present time leads to thicknesses formation with the capacity of mainly 3–5 m (up to 30 m). The role of geological activity of animals and plant organisms in the transformation of earth surface relies and the structure of rocks making it up is characterized.
